DUBAI: du, from Emirates Integrated Telecommun­ications Company (EITC), has announced a new partnershi­p with Fazaa, an initiative which aims to develop social interdepen­dence and maintain solidarity within the UAE community, to provide an exclusive National Day offer.

All UAE residents who hold a Fazaa card, which is part of a UAE rewards programme which gives members access to exclusive offers and services, can benefit from excellent value for money, extensive data and minutes, and free internet calling by acquiring plans that will be available for one month beginning on December 2nd.

To announce the new partnershi­p, both entities conducted a virtual signing ceremony, which was atended by Fahad Al Hasawi, Acting CEO, du and Col. Ahmed Buharoon Al Shamsi, CEO, Fazaa.

At present all Fazaa cardholder­s who are du customers can get up to 36GB of data and many national and internatio­nal minutes for Dhs170 per month.

Additional­ly, if you are a new customers you can avail the e-store Fazaa national Day offer on top of the Fazaa current package, which includes no activation fees, an additional 75GB Free for 3 months, and the first month completely free of charge.
